File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 44 "spec_versions": {
55 "v1": {
66 "apigentools_version": "1.5.1.dev2",
7- "regenerated": "2021-12-03 09:51:58.954001 ",
8- "spec_repo_commit": "1c2091d "
7+ "regenerated": "2021-12-03 10:57:34.225994 ",
8+ "spec_repo_commit": "df5b6af "
99 },
1010 "v2": {
1111 "apigentools_version": "1.5.1.dev2",
12- "regenerated": "2021-12-03 09:51:58.982861 ",
13- "spec_repo_commit": "1c2091d "
12+ "regenerated": "2021-12-03 10:57:34.264480 ",
13+ "spec_repo_commit": "df5b6af "
1414 }
1515 }
1616}
Original file line number Diff line number Diff line change 1+ # Update a role returns "OK" response
12
3+ require "datadog_api_client"
4+ api_instance = DatadogAPIClient ::V2 ::RolesAPI . new
5+
6+ # there is a valid "role" in the system
7+ ROLE_DATA_ATTRIBUTES_NAME = ENV [ "ROLE_DATA_ATTRIBUTES_NAME" ]
8+ ROLE_DATA_ID = ENV [ "ROLE_DATA_ID" ]
9+
10+ body = DatadogAPIClient ::V2 ::RoleUpdateRequest . new ( {
11+ data : DatadogAPIClient ::V2 ::RoleUpdateData . new ( {
12+ id : ROLE_DATA_ID ,
13+ type : DatadogAPIClient ::V2 ::RolesType ::ROLES ,
14+ attributes : DatadogAPIClient ::V2 ::RoleUpdateAttributes . new ( {
15+ name : "developers-updated" ,
16+ } ) ,
17+ } ) ,
18+ } )
19+ p api_instance . update_role ( ROLE_DATA_ID , body )
You can’t perform that action at this time.
0 commit comments